Building Faith-Filled Moments into the Beauty of Autumn

As the cool air sets in and leaves change color, fall invites us to embrace the beauty of God's creation. It also presents the perfect opportunity to reflect on our faith and bring Christ to the forefront of our family traditions. Here are seven ways to infuse your autumn activities with the love of Christ, fostering spiritual growth and unity in your home.

1. Begin with a Family Prayer Walk
Fall's crisp weather is ideal for outdoor activities. Turn your usual walks into moments of gratitude by reflecting on the beauty of God's creation. As you walk, pray together, thanking God for His blessings, the changing seasons, and the gift of nature. Encourage your children to notice the small wonders--each falling leaf can remind us of God's care for even the smallest details in our lives.

2. Celebrate the Feasts of Saints
Autumn is full of important Catholic feast days, such as All Saints' Day and the feast of St. Michael the Archangel. Incorporate these feast days into your family's fall traditions. You can have a special meal, decorate your home with images of saints, or organize a family activity that reflects the virtues of the saint you're honoring. It's a wonderful way to keep Christ and His saints at the center of your home life.

3. Host a Family Rosary Night Around the Fire
As the days get shorter, spend time together as a family around a cozy fire. Whether inside by the fireplace or outside around a fire pit, make this an intentional time to pray the rosary. Use the warmth of the fire as a symbol of Christ's light in our hearts, and offer your intentions for loved ones, those in need, and the strength to live out your faith.

4. Create a Christ-Centered Gratitude Tree
Gratitude is central to our Catholic faith. Create a ‽Gratitude Tree" with your family, where each member writes down something they are thankful for on a paper leaf. As the tree fills up, you'll have a visual reminder of God's generosity and grace. As part of your daily prayer, have each person choose a leaf to reflect on and offer thanks to God.

5. Volunteer Together as a Family
As Thanksgiving approaches, embrace the spirit of giving by volunteering as a family. Whether it's helping at a local food pantry, visiting the elderly, or participating in your parish's charitable activities, these acts of service reflect Christ's love for others. Use this time to teach your children the importance of compassion and generosity as a response to God's love.

6. Bake and Share Fall-Themed Treats with a Blessing
Turn your baking into a moment of faith by praying together before you begin. You can bake fall-themed cookies, pies, or breads and share them with neighbors or those in need. Attach a simple prayer or blessing to each treat, reminding others of Christ's presence in every gift we give.

7. End with a Family Bonfire and Scripture Reflection
End your fall festivities by gathering around a bonfire to reflect on Scripture. Choose passages that reflect God's creation, thankfulness, or the call to holiness. Take turns reading and sharing how God is speaking to you through His Word. This is a beautiful way to close out the season with hearts focused on Christ and each other.

By intentionally weaving Christ into your family's fall traditions, you create lasting memories that go beyond the fun and festivity, grounding your family in faith and love for the Lord. Let this season be a time to grow closer to Christ and to each other.
